146632709897674 is an even composite number. It is composed of seven dist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of four hundred thirty-two divisors.

Prime factorization of 146632709897674:

2 × 72 × 11 × 13 × 19 × 312 × 7572

(2 × 7 × 7 × 11 × 13 × 19 × 31 × 31 × 757 × 757)
